If you’re using long-term storage for the first time, it can be a little daunting. You want to make sure your belongings are safe and sound, but you also don’t want to spend a fortune on storage fees. Here are a few tips to help make the most of your long-term storage experience:
1. Choose the right storage unit.
Not all storage units are created equal. Make sure you choose one that is climate controlled and has a fire suppression system. This will help protect your belongings from damage caused by extreme temperatures or fires.
2. Pack wisely.
Pack your belongings carefully, using boxes and packing materials that will protect them from damage. If you’re storing fragile items, be sure to pack them with extra care.
3. Label everything.
It’s important to label each box with its contents so you can easily find what you need when you’re ready to access your belongings again. This will also help ensure that nothing gets misplaced during storage.
4. Keep track of your inventory.
Make a list of everything you’re storing and keep it in a safe place. This will come in handy if you need to access anything during your storage period.
5. Inspect your belongings regularly.
Take a look at your belongings every few months to make sure they haven’t been damaged during storage. If you notice any damage, take action right away to prevent further damage.
